JAKARTA, KOMPAS.com – Indonesian President Jokowi has underlined the immense importance of cooperation among ASEAN Member-States in the fight against the coronavirus pandemic.
At the 36th ASEAN Summit on June 26, Jokowi said strengthening cooperation among ASEAN countries would renew the hope of partnership that is effective, efficient, and fair.

“In the midst of pessimism towards multilateralism, regional cooperation has become more important. ASEAN must be the subject and not an object in global politics,” said Jokowi via teleconference.
The number of violations made on international agreements is evidence of the pessimism towards multilateralism.
In the new era or new normal for the world, enhanced cooperation at the ASEAN level can serve as a catalyst in maintaining regional stability and peace.

As such, ASEAN centrality and unity must be realized.
“ASEAN must be the guardian of our own region not the projection of power by bigger nations,” said Jokowi.
Strengthening the ASEAN Outlook on the Indo-Pacific is one measure that ASEAN countries can take to improve regional cooperation.
